[QUOTE="rmc_olderthandirt, post: 1436937, member: 68872"] It sounds like the master link is not compatible with the chain. Did the master link come with the chain, or were they purchased separately? I have always gotten a new master link along with a chain and then they should match. There shouldn't be any gap between the plate and clip. If there is, something is wrong. If it was an O-Ring chain and you managed to drop the O-rings out that could account for the gap. Look around and see if there are four little tiny doughnut looking things lying about. Rod [/QUOTE]
